Losing access to your Bitcoin wallet can be a devastating experience. But don't despair! This comprehensive guide will walk you through the process of restoring your wallet and reclaiming your funds. First, determine the type of wallet you used - hardware wallets, software wallets, or online wallets each have their own restoration methods. Assemble your wallet's seed phrase, a unique string of copyright that grants access to your funds.
Keep in mind, this phrase is incredibly sensitive and should be protected with the utmost care. If you've misplaced your seed phrase, recovery may be challenging. Explore backup options like encrypted files or third-party recovery services. When restoring your wallet, meticulously enter your seed phrase following the wallet's instructions. Double-check each word to avoid errors that could result in permanent loss of funds.
